Latest Patents

Among her latest patents is a groundbreaking invention related to alumina-based nitrogen oxide (NOx) trapping compositions. This invention focuses on thermally stable, solid alumina-based compositions that effectively trap nitrogen oxides found in vehicular exhaust gases. The compositions are formed of alumina, cerium, and a divalent metal selected from barium or strontium, ensuring that at least 10% of the weight of the metal is expressed as oxide. Notably, the aluminate compound of the metal element is absent and undetectable by X-ray diffraction after calcination.

Another significant patent involves abrasive compositions for chemical mechanical polishing. This invention includes a colloidal dispersion that comprises an abrasive component and a water-soluble amphoteric polymer. The dispersion is designed to polish substrates made of silicon nitride and silicon oxide, achieving a reverse selectivity ratio that enhances the efficiency of the polishing process.
